The alarm of the Susan Class 1 and 2 is an attractive opportunity to learn the concept of shadows. With practical experiments, games and creative activities, children are introduced to light, body and shadows and reinforce their scientific observation and thinking skills. 1
Learning about shadows is one of the fascinating and practical activities in the science bell. Children understand basic scientific concepts such as light, body, and obstacles by observing the effect of light on objects and shaping the shadows. 🌞🔬
Practical activities can include the use of flashlights, the sun and different objects to create different shades. By changing the angle and distance of the light, children observe and examine the different effects of the shade and learn how the shadows form and move. 🖐️✨
Group games and creative activities also enhance social skills and children's collaboration. They learn how to work with their friends and do the tests carefully. 🤝🎨
The use of simple and colorful items, cards and even shadows painting makes learning experience more attractive and enhances children's interest in science. These activities enhance their observation skills, rational thinking and creativity. 👩🔬
Finally, the shadows teaching in the Susan Science A bell not only enhances the scientific understanding of children, but also provides a fun and practical experience to learn basic science skills. 🔬💛
